Study this timeline. Which event belongs on the blank line? 200 C.E. Height of the Roman Empire 330 C.E. _______________________
8_murik_8 [283]

Answer:

d. The Roman capital moves to Byzantium.

Explanation:

In the year 330 C.E., empreror Constantine moved the Empire capital from Rome to Byzantium, located in the strait of bosphorus, between Anatolia and Greece.

The emperor also changed the name of the city, after him: Constantinople. From this moment on, Constantinople would continue to be a larger and more important city than Rome, which would continue to decline.
